Freight forwarding software built around the shipment file

A scoped Codeblix workflow blueprint for Mauritius freight forwarders—not a claim that every specialist freight feature is pre-built.

Bring shipment milestones, operational documents, customer updates and billing references into one traceable workflow, with the final fiscal invoice handled through Codeblix EBS.

1

Create the shipment file

Record the customer, route, mode, reference numbers, parties, expected dates and commercial notes in one operational record.

2

Track milestones

Use agreed statuses for booking, departure, arrival, customs, delivery and closure so the next action is visible.

3

Control documents and exceptions

Associate quotes, invoices and delivery documents with the shipment, then record missing documents or delayed milestones as exceptions.

4

Move from charges to billing

Review approved shipment charges before creating the customer document and MRA-compliant fiscal invoice.

Scope first

What Codeblix would confirm before implementation

This page is an operational blueprint. The final workflow, screens, permissions and integrations depend on your current process and agreed implementation scope.

  • Shipment modes, branches, roles and approval rules
  • Required reference numbers, statuses and operational documents
  • Customer update, exception and escalation rules
  • Charge lines, currencies, invoice timing and accounting handoff
